This idiom can be used with or without "a" at the beginning. Often, people just say 'penny for your thoughts?" As indicated by the question mark, the expression is often, but not always, used with a questioning inflection. This underscores the meaning of the idiom, as we are really asking "what are you thinking?"

English idioms are types of English sayings, expressions, or phrases. However, an idiom is different from other sayings or expressions. It is a phrase that behaves more like a word. The meaning of an idiom is not always easy to tell based on the words used. They are groups of words that mean something different than they appear to mean.
Note on idiom origins: Rarely do we know the exact point of origin for particular idioms. Usually, historical research is used to understand why the context of a particular idiom and how and why it came about. Therefore, idiom history is much the same as idiom origin. However, a few idioms can be traced to one person or event.
